political profile
  • Senate District:28
  • First Elected:2010
  • Terms Out:2026
  • Party:Republican
  • Delegations:Collier,Hendry,Lee
  • District Information:District map
  • Legislative Service:Elected to the Florida Senate in 2016, reelected subsequently
    Majority (Republican) Leader, 2018-2020
    Florida House of Representatives, 2010-2016
PERSONAL INFO
  • Born:May 19, 1953, Jersey City, NJ
  • Moved to Florida:1979
  • Religious Affiliation:Roman Catholic
  • Education:Trinity University, Washington D.C., B.A., 1975
    Stetson University College of Law, J.D., 1978
  • Occupation:Attorney; Kelly, Passidomo & Kelly, LLP
  • Spouse:John M. Passidomo of Naples, FL
  • Children:Catarina, Francesca, Gabriella
  • Grandchildren:William, Emilio
